Blake Lively has filed a new motion requesting the judge to move the location of her forthcoming testimony in the ongoing legal saga between her and Baldoni.

The request comes after Lively, 37, accused her It Ends With Us director-costar Baldoni, 47, of sexual harassment and retaliation, which he has denied.

Lively’s request comes after Baldoni’s attorney, Bryan Freedman, who said in May that Lively’s deposition should be held at Madison Square Garden in New York City.

He said, “Hold the deposition at MSG, sell tickets or stream it, and donate every dollar to organizations helping victims of domestic violence.”

Blake Lively fears It’s a media trial!

On the other hand, Lively see it as a mere ‘publicity’ stunt of Baldoni’s team to tarnish her image in a media trial. 

“Justin Baldoni’s lawyer has tried to make this matter a public spectacle at every turn, even proposing to sell tickets to a televised deposition at MSG,” Blake Lively said labelling the filmmaker's statement as “a matter of sexual harassment and retaliation and it deserves to be treated as such”.

Since then, both the legal teams have spoken about their next steps, including Lively's deposition. Lively's lawyer, Mike Gottlieb told PEOPLE in May, "The ultimate moment for a plaintiff's story to be told is at trial." 

"We expect that to be the case here [with Lively]. So, we would, of course, expect her to be a witness at her trial. Of course she’s going to testify," he added.

"We have all of the videotape, all the footage," Baldoni's lawyer Freedman said. "We have, you know, the text messages and we have emails. We're gonna see how consistent her testimony is with the actual facts of what transpired," he added.

Their trial is set for March 2026 in New York, and attorneys for both Lively and Baldoni have indicated that they plan to testify during the proceedings.
